Types of Gym Bicycles

Gym bicycles can be found in various kinds, each accommodating different fitness requirements and preferences. Below is a comprehensive table showcasing the main kinds of gym bicycles offered:

Type of Gym Bicycle Description Perfect For
Upright Bike Mimics a traditional road bicycle; users cycle in a seated position. Those searching for a high-intensity exercise.
Recumbent Bike Functions a larger seat and back support, leaning users back throughout biking. Individuals with pain in the back or mobility problems.
Spin Bike Designed for intense biking sessions, often used in group classes. Spin lovers and advanced cyclists.
Air Bike Utilizes fan resistance; the much faster the pedaling, the higher the resistance. High-intensity period training (HIIT) fans.
Hybrid Bike Combines functions of different types, using versatile usage. General fitness enthusiasts looking for a well balanced workout.

Advantages of Using Gym Bicycles

Gym bicycles offer various advantages for people seeking to boost their fitness journey. Here are some significant advantages:

  1. Cardiovascular Fitness: Cycling helps strengthen the heart and lungs, improving total cardiovascular health.

  2. Low-Impact Exercise: Unlike running, biking is much easier on the joints, making it an ideal alternative for people with arthritis or those recovering from injury.

  3. Weight-loss and Fat Burning: Regular biking sessions can burn a substantial variety of calories, helping in weight reduction efforts.

  4. Muscle Tone and Strength: Cycling engages different muscle groups, consisting of the quadriceps, hamstrings, calves, and glutes, helping in muscle toning.

  5. Enhanced Coordination and Balance: Cycling requires core stabilization, thereby enhancing general body coordination and balance.

  6. Mental Health Benefits: Engaging in physical activity, including cycling, releases endorphins, assisting to improve state of mind and reduce stress levels.

How to Incorporate Gym Bicycles into Your Routine

Including gym bicycles in an exercise routine can be smooth and satisfying. Here is a suggested plan for integrating biking exercises:

Setting Goals

  • Define your fitness goals: Determine whether you’re looking to slim down, develop endurance, or simply stay active.

Set Up Cycling Sessions

  • Frequency: Aim for a minimum of 3– 5 biking sessions per week.
  • Period: Start with 20– 30 minutes per session and gradually increase to 60 minutes as endurance builds.

Varying Intensity

  • Interval Training: Alternate in between durations of high-intensity biking and lower-intensity healing, such as:
    • 1 minute of fast pedaling
    • 2 minutes of slow recovery

Display Progress

  • Track Workouts: Use fitness apps or wearable devices to keep a record of cycling duration, distance, and intensity.

FAQs About Gym Bicycles

1. What are the differences in between upright bikes and recumbent bikes?

Upright bikes mimic standard bicycles, motivating an upright position that engages the core more actively. Recumbent bikes offer back assistance and a reclined position, making them more comfortable for users with back concerns.

2. Can I lose weight by using a gym bicycle?

Yes, using a gym bicycle can be an effective part of a weight loss strategy, particularly when integrated with a balanced diet plan and a calorie deficit.

3. How can I prevent discomfort while biking?

Ensure your bike is properly adapted to fit your height. Additionally, think about padded shorts and shoes for extra comfort throughout longer sessions.

4. Is it safe for older adults to utilize gym bicycles?

Yes, stationary bicycles are normally safe for older adults, as they provide a low-impact form of exercise that can boost cardiovascular fitness without excessive pressure on the joints.

5. How often should I utilize a gym bicycle?

Go for a minimum of 3– 5 times per week, adjusting frequency based on fitness levels and personal goals.
